  2. Ahmad ibn Hanbal (Arabic: أَحْمَد بْن حَنْبَل, romanized: Aḥmad ibn Ḥanbal; November 780 – 2 August 855) was a Sunni Muslim scholar, jurist, theologian, traditionist, ascetic and eponym of the Hanbali school of Islamic jurisprudence—one of the four major orthodox legal schools of Sunni Islam.

  6. Aḥmad ibn Ḥanbal, (born 780, Baghdad, Iraq—died 855, Baghdad), Muslim theologian and jurist. He began to study the Ḥadīth (Traditions) at age 15. He traveled widely to study with the great masters and made five pilgrimages to Mecca.
